V dnešnej dobe sa v hojnej miere začal rozširovať nový druh prepojenia PC komponentov a to je PCI-E bus. Jeho snahou je vytlačiť zo všetkých počítačov staršie typy zariadení. Než ale kúpite dosku zvážte či vám to naozaj stojí za to.
Typy "klasického" PCI slotu.
PCI 2.1
tento štandard pracuje na frekvencii 33 mhz a prepustí 133mb/s
PCI 2.2
dovoluje 66mhz pri 3.3 voltoch(requires 3.3 volt signalling) a jeho priepustnosť je 266mhz.
PCI 2.3
rovnnaký ako predchádzajúci model ale už nedokáže pracovať s 5 voltami
PCI 3.0 detto
Vzhladom na verziu a vek vašej dosky môže mať rozličná doska rôznu priepustnosť.
Vezmime si na mušku nejaké zariadenie schopné túto kapacitu naplniť. Ak pracujete s PCI2.1 slotom a máte k dispozícii SCSI 160 radič môže sa vám stať že táto karta na plnej rýchlosti bude nabúravať iné procesy ktoré pracujú na PCI slote.
Pokial máte TV tuner a preženiete cez SCSI disk dáta ak radič aj rozhranie bežia na 160 mb/s môže sa stať že dôjde k rozbitiu obrazu na TV tuneri pokial disk pracuje.
Riešením je bud použiť funkciu v biose "PCI bus Timeout" ktorá spomaluje moc rýchle procesy (ale zároveň znižuje výkon celého systému), alebo znížiť trasfer rate na SCSI karte na 80mb/s čo ale môže ovplyvniť rýchlejšie disky.
Pokial ale máte PCI slot s lepšou priepustnosťou - 266mb/s tak váš pci bus bude fungovať bez problému.
Prejdime teraz k AGP slotu
AGP 1x
je úplne prvý štandard. pracoval na 66 mhz a dosahoval priepustnosť 266mb/s
AGP 2x, 4x, 8x
všetky tieto štandardy plne kopírovali fungovanie AGP1x s tým že sa pridávalo viac ciest cez ktoré dáta tiekli a menila sa voltáž. Nie všetky karty môžu pracovať na každom AGP slote. ich priepustnosť rástla na 533,1066 a 2133mb/s
Vezmime si na mušku zariadenia. AGP bol prvý druh slotu ktorý potreboval viac než 133mb/s. U agp2x ešte bolo jasne cítiť že dátové toky využívajú túto kapacitu, ale u vyšších rýchlostí agp si už mnoho užívatelov určite všimlo že vyššia rýchlosť slotu už neprináša výsledky vo výkone stroja.
je to spôsobené bud parametrami CPU a GPU, alebo tým faktom že prenosy dát medzi RAM a Video RAM sú velmi malé (napríklad u kariet s dostatkom videopamäte)
Paradoxom je že ak keď sa grafické kapacity týchto slotov bežne nedajú dosiahnuť vývoj je už omnoho viac vpredu a ponúka ešte širšie priepustnosti.
PCI-E
Rýchlosť tohoto slotu je definovaná jeho tvarom a ničím iným. Každé PCI-E zariadenie môže využívať ku komunikácii viac ciest na karte. čím viac ciest a čím dlhší je konektor tým viac dát cez slot pretečie.
čo možno neviete je že ak máte PCI-E 16x slot aký sa bežne používa na grafické karty tak do toho istého slotu môžete použiť PCI-E kartu menších rozmerov (napr kartu určenú pre PCI-E 1x)
PCI-E 1x
Priepustnosť 266mb/s
PCI-E 4x, 8x, 12x, 16x, 32x
priepustnosť 1064mb/s až 8512 mb/s
tento typ slotu je velmi zaujímavo technicky riešený pretože ak nemáte dostatok slotov na malé karty môžte použiť aj velký slot určený grafike - ničmenej je to plytvanie.
Vezmime si ale na mušku niektoré zariadenia ktoré sa na tento typ slotu vyrábajú, povedzme napr SATA 300 karta...
karta s ktorou som mal možnosť pracovať síce ponúkala až 300mb prenosy, ale bola osadená konektorom pre PCI-E 1x ktorý limituje prenosy na 266mb/s. Fyzicky je teda nemožné cez tento slot dáta ktorými SATA operuje pretlačiť a to mierne degraduje dátové transfery. Druhou stranou mince je ale ten fakt že na to aby ste na tento limit narazili potrebujete docela rýchly multidiskový raid.
Na mieste je však otázka ako sú v tomto prípade riešené onboard SATA radiče. Pokial sú tiež napojené takouto formou tak je to trochu technický zádrhel...
Pozrime sa teda na tieto údaje triezvo. U bežných PCI zariadení sa len u niektorých docela výkonných diskových radičov podarilo dosiahnuť tak vysokých dátových transferov aby bežný PCI 2.1 nebol dostatočný.
Pokial máte výkonné harddisky ako Raptor a máte ich v raide tak vám postačí PCI staršieho štandardu, hoci transfery je treba cez bios neobratne radiť timeoutom aby nekolidovali, alebo znížiť výkon daného radiča.
Pokial používate Raidy vyšších výkonnostných tried a naozaj ste ochotný naň zavesiť aj harddisky ktoré túto kapacitu využijú tak máte stále na vyber 66mhz PCI slot, alebo PCI-E 1x. Oba tieto sloty majú naprosto rovnakú priepustnosť a v prípade oboch týchto slotov je výkon SATA 300 alebo SCSI 320 radiču redukovaný bud konštrukčne, alebo je nutné tak spraviť v biose.
Pokial chcete využiť kapacitu SATA 300 alebo SAS/SCSI 320 na rozumnej úrovni ktorá nezníži ani výkon systému ani výkon radiča a ani výkon harddisku potrebujete minimálne rozhranie PCI-E 2x - onboard riešené diskové radiče túto podmienku spĺňať môžu ale nemusia.
Čo sa týka grafických kariet tak hrubá priepustnosť ktorú potrebujú k bezchybnému fungovaniu bola dosiahnutá už docela dávno, pričom výmena konektorov v dnešnej dobe sa dá charakterizovať skôr ako marketingový ťah.
Aby som bol ale úplne spravodlivý je jednoduchšie a lacnejšie vyrobiť dosku ktorá má 6 rôznych PCI-E slotov ktoré fungujú na rovnakom princípe než vyrobiť dosku ktorá pracuje s dvoma úplne odlišnými štandardmi a každý z nich potrebuje iný druh radiča a samozrejme fungovanie a práca systému s jediným druhom radiča je jednoduchšia, aneb je docela dobré že grafika je znova na rovnakej lodi ako ostatné zariadenia.
ideálna moderná doska vyzerá asi tak že sú na nej osadené výhradne PCI-E 32x sloty a užívatel má v tomto prípade úplnú slobodu vo výbere, časť týchto vecí je ale stále vo vývoji tak sa nechám prekvapiť

určitým obmedzením je ale to že nie všetky zariadenia (napr zvukkové karty a tv tunery) prešli na PCIE slot. zatial sa v tomto odvetví objavujú len prvé lastovičky.
Paradoxne ak tu máme tak rýchly radič ktorý bežne dokáže zapisovať až 8gb/s otázka je ako rýchlo dokáže zapisovať vaša ram

Pokial sa pachtíte po ideálnych strojoch bez bottleneckov museli by ste k akémukolvek PCI-E zariadeniu mať pamäte schopné zapisovať 8giga v sekunde, našťastie bežne sa používa len 4gb/s PCI-E x16 slot aký je typický pre grafické karty.